PSCI 4236

American Foreign Policy

Examines the postwar events, controversies, and most recent challenges in U.S. foreign policy. Analyses of the major sources of U.S. foreign policy, such as ideology, national interests, and national power. Attention to the pattern and process of foreign policy-making.

Units: 3.0

Hours: 3 to 3
